Company Background
Based in Chicago, SimpleComm's mission is to be the long-term trusted advisor for all its clients. technology and communications needs. SimpleComm prides itself on working with companies of all sizes. Founded by Peter Fitzgerald and Steven Levine in 2002, the firm has grown steadily and now employs eleven direct employees and numerous subcontractors.

- Value to Clients
SimpleComm sells most of the business services in the Speakeasy portfolio, allowing them to meet a wide range of client needs cost-effectively. Recently they.ve noticed huge client demand for back-up and disaster recovery sites, which they often support with Speakeasy T1s.
For another client, they connected 36 remote locations using Speakeasy's Private Networking over DSL. Speakeasy's technology made it possible to link all the locations to one T1 at the main office with no need for firewalls because of the security afforded by the private IP network. At just $100 per location, this was an affordable solution for the client and solid recurring monthly revenue for SimpleComm.
